Understanding Child Development in the Digital Age: A New Perspective on Bronfenbrenner's Bioecological Model

The study of child development has taken a significant step forward with recent advancements in Urie Bronfenbrenner's Bioecological Model. This model, originally proposed in the 1970s, has been expanded and updated to better reflect the complexities of contemporary life, particularly in the digital age and multicultural contexts.

1. The Expansion of the Bioecological Model and the PPCT Framework

Bronfenbrenner’s model has evolved into the Process-Person-Context-Time (PPCT) framework. This updated model emphasizes the intricate, reciprocal, and temporally dynamic interactions that shape development. The model highlights four key aspects:

  • Processes: Proximal interactions, such as daily activities and interpersonal exchanges with people, symbols, and objects.
  • Person: Individual characteristics influencing engagement and outcomes.
  • Context: Nested systems ranging from microsystems (immediate environments like school or family) to macrosystems (broader cultural and societal values).
  • Time: The chronosystem, reflecting developmental changes across the lifespan and historical contexts.

2. Virtual Microsystems

A significant extension of the original model is the concept of a virtual microsystem—a child's immediate environment enriched with digital and online interactions. Recent scholarship recognizes that virtual spaces (e.g., online classrooms, social media, gaming environments) function as significant contexts where proximal processes occur, influencing socialization and development similarly to physical microsystems. This digital dimension requires a nuanced examination of how children engage with digital media as part of their everyday interactive processes, extending Bronfenbrenner's original ecological layers.

3. Culturally Pervasive Influences and the Macrosystem

The macrosystem level, incorporating dominant cultural values, beliefs, and ideologies, is increasingly recognized as deeply influential, especially in multicultural and globalized settings. Research stresses the importance of culturally informed bioecological perspectives that account for systemic biases, cultural narratives, and community practices permeating child development contexts. This includes how social identities and cultural frameworks shape children's access to resources and the quality of proximal processes within microsystems and mesosystems.

4. Interaction of System Levels in Contemporary Contexts

Current studies highlight the multidirectional and compounding interplay between proximal and distal factors, such as how socioeconomic risks, cultural values, and virtual environments interact dynamically over time to influence outcomes like mental health or educational engagement. These interactions are not linear but reciprocal, with feedback loops reinforcing or mitigating developmental risks and protective factors.

5. Implications for Research and Practice

The evolution towards a bioecological understanding nuanced by digital microsystems and culturally pervasive influences encourages:

  • Holistic and longitudinal research methodologies integrating virtual and offline environments.
  • Culturally sensitive interventions that address systemic inequities and leverage community strengths.
  • Recognition that child development is shaped by complex systemic interdependencies that adapt and shift in digital and multicultural landscapes.

In summary, recent developments in Bronfenbrenner’s Bioecological Model extend its foundational concepts to include virtual microsystems as critical environments and emphasize the potent role of cultural contexts at the macrosystem level. These advances underscore the model’s utility for understanding child development amid the complexity of 21st-century social and technological realities.
